Early tree shapingThe goal of shaping the tree is a round shape, and the whole plant should be compact without affecting ventilation and light transmission. When the plants are planted, pruning is done at a distance of 40 to 50 cm from the ground. In fact, it is mainly for topping. After the new branches grow out, only 3 to 4 branches need to be left, evenly distributed on the main trunk. When the main branches grow to 30 cm to 40 cm long, they can be pinched off. Only 2 to 3 new buds need to be retained on each branch. If there are weaker branches or branches that are too thin, you can use other wooden strips or ropes to shape them to prevent them from hanging downwards. Pruning during the fruiting periodWhen it comes to the results stage, there is no need for such large-scale operations. At this time, light pruning is required, and the middle and lower branches should not be pruned as much as possible. Mainly prune the overgrown branches. These branches grow very vigorously, but the amount of fruit they produce is very small, and will destroy the overall shape of the tree, while also absorbing most of the nutrients. Branches that are weaker in growth and seriously infested with diseases and insect pests should also be pruned at this time. Sometimes, in order to improve the quality and taste of the fruit, you can also pick the flowers at an appropriate time. Although this reduces the fruit yield, it can ensure that the remaining fruit will taste more delicious. |
